Definition and Construction of Entropy Satisfying Multiresolution Analysis (MRA)

This paper considers some numerical schemes for the approximate solution of conservation laws and various wavelet methods are reviewed. This is followed by the construction of wavelet spaces based on a polynomial framework for the approximate solution of conservation laws. Construction of a representation of the approximate solution in terms of an entropy satisfying Multiresolution Analysis (MRA) is deļ¬ned. Finally, a proof of convergence of the approximate solution of conservation laws using the characterization provided by the basis functions in the MRA will be given.
